For example, I am separating FCC gasoline into light and heavy fractions. It is known that about 30% of the light components in FCC gasoline can be fed into the process, and the D86 value of the entire FCC gasoline is also known. Through calculations, it can be determined that when the overhead yield (D/F) is 40%, the separation results show that almost all of the light components end up in the overhead product; the remaining components are the virtual components starting from PC47. My question is: when entering these virtual components, there is an option labeled “Optional”, under which there are two checkboxes: “Apply cracking correction” and “Match light ends with distillation curves”. I didn’t select either of them, and the calculations I got seem reasonable, fairly accurate compared to experimental values. I believe that the actual calculation of the light components already takes into account the D86 value. The problem is that whenever I select “Match light ends with distillation curves”, the system gives an error. I would like to ask the experts here – could anyone explain the underlying calculation methods used, including the thermodynamic properties employed? What do these two checkboxes mean? Thank you
